The Fund For Public Interest Research (FFPIR)

The Fund for Public Interest Research is a national nonprofit organization working to increase the visibility, membership and political power of the nation’s leading environmental and progressive groups. The Fund for Public Interest Research is best known for its canvass programs. Over the years The Fund has developed the nation's largest and most effective network for door-to-door and street canvassing—signing up members in high traffic, public places. The Fund signs up sustainers—members who commit to automatic monthly contributions from a checking account or credit card—as well as one-time contributors. The Fund for Public Interest Research works with Environment Ohio in Columbus and other cities throughout Ohio.
